You can create a new intake form from scratch or search Word's template database to find a premade solution. In either case, you'll need to enable Word's Developer menu to create and edit the form. You can find it under File > Options > Customize Ribbon. Check the Developer box in the right-hand column.
Create a client intake form using a fillable PDF. Launch Acrobat. Click Tools > Prepare Form. Select a file or scan a document. Add new form fields. These form fields can ask for a name, email, reason for requesting services, and more. Click Distribute to collect responses automatically.

An intake form is a document used to gather important information from clients, customers, or patients when they first interact with a service or organization. It typically includes basic details like contact information, purpose of seeking services, and other relevant data.
The form typically includes personal information, such as the client's contact details, medical history, and current concerns and reasons for seeking therapy. The therapy intake form is important because it provides the therapist with critical information about the client to help guide the therapy process.
